Types of Car Insurance Available in Kenya
Before choosing a company, understand the available coverage options.
Comprehensive Insurance
Provides the broadest protection.
Covers:
- Accidental damage
- Theft
- Fire
- Third-party claims
Best for newer vehicles.
Third-Party Insurance
This is the minimum legal requirement.
It covers damage caused to other people and their property.
Best for:
- Older vehicles
- Budget-conscious drivers
Third-Party Fire and Theft
Provides:
- Third-party protection
- Fire coverage
- Theft protection
A middle option between basic and comprehensive cover.
How to Choose the Best Car Insurance Company
Many people ask why they should use these car insurance companies in Kenya instead of simply choosing the cheapest option.
Price is important, but several other factors matter.
Claims Processing Speed
Choose companies known for handling claims efficiently.
Financial Stability
Financially strong insurers are more likely to settle claims reliably.
Approved Garage Network
Ensure your insurer works with reputable garages in your city.
Customer Reviews
Check real customer experiences before purchasing a policy.
Coverage Options
Always compare:
- Benefits
- Exclusions
- Excess charges
- Add-on services

Common Mistakes Drivers Make
Choosing Insurance Based Only on Price
The cheapest policy may not provide the best value.
Ignoring Policy Exclusions
Always read the policy document carefully.
Underinsuring Your Vehicle
Ensure the insured value reflects the vehicle’s market value.
Missing Premium Payments
Late payments can affect coverage validity.

2. What is the difference between comprehensive and third-party insurance?
Comprehensive insurance covers your vehicle and third-party damage, while third-party insurance only covers damage caused to others.
3. Is car insurance mandatory in Kenya?
Yes. At minimum, third-party insurance is legally required.
